<self-uri xlink:href="http://scielo.pt/scielo.php?script=sci_arttext&amp;pid=S0872-01692021000200084&amp;lng=en&amp;nrm=iso"></self-uri><self-uri xlink:href="http://scielo.pt/scielo.php?script=sci_abstract&amp;pid=S0872-01692021000200084&amp;lng=en&amp;nrm=iso"></self-uri><self-uri xlink:href="http://scielo.pt/scielo.php?script=sci_pdf&amp;pid=S0872-01692021000200084&amp;lng=en&amp;nrm=iso"></self-uri><abstract abstract-type="short" xml:lang="en"><p><![CDATA[ABSTRACT Chronic kidney disease is an increasingly common diagnosis in the very elderly and identifying the patients who benefit from a nephrologist&#8217;s intervention and the ones who would not might avoid wasteful or harmful interventions. The aim of this study is to identify the risk factos for progressive versus non&#8209;progressive chronic kidney disease in a population aged over 80 years old. We performed a cohort single&#8209;center retrospective study including 101 patients over 80 years old with chronic kidney disease diagnosed for at least five years and followed regularly by a nephrologist. Progressive disease was defined as glomerular filtration rate declines greater than 5 mL/min/1.73 m2/year. Of the 101 patients, 33.7% had progressive chronic kidney disease. The median glomerular filtration progression rate was 3.0 [2.1&#8209;6.0] mL/min/1.73m2/year. Hypertension and diabetes mellitus prevalence was similar between groups. Nephrology follow&#8209;up time was longer in the progressive group (5.0 vs 2.0 years, p=0.01). Regarding chronic kidney disease complications, 37.6% had anemia and half of these needed erythropoiesis&#8209;stimulating agents. None of the patients had hyperphosphatemia. About 18.8% presented metabolic acidosis. In multivariable analysis, after adjusting for covariables such as age, hypertension, and diabetes mellitus only the presence of metabolic acidosis (OR 0.4, CI: 0.1&#8209;0.8) was associated with the development of progressive chronic kidney disease. Progressive chronic kidney disease group presented higher mortality (log rank 4.5, p=0.03). Ischemic cardiomyopathy (OR: 0.5, CI: 0.2&#8209;0.9) and progressive chronic kidney disease (OR: 0.6, CI:0.3&#8209;0.8) were associated with all&#8209;cause mortality. Our results showed that most elderly patients have non&#8209;progressive chronic kidney disease. Patients with metabolic acidosis seem to be at an increased risk for developing progressive disease. Most elderly patients die before reaching end&#8209;stage kidney disease, so it is importante to look at progressive kidney disease in those patients as an important marker of comorbidity and privilege cardioprotective measures.]]></p></abstract>
